Ipswich Town’s international Round Up
Source: Vital Football
Published 1 day ago
Seven Ipswich Town first team players were involved during the international break as their nations chased World Cup places, while many more featured in friendlies and youth fixtures and only on‑loan striker Ali Al‑Hamadi secured World Cup qualification this International Window. Ali Al-Hamadi, who is currently on loan at Luton, opened the scoring in Monterrey as Iraq won 2-1 against Bolivia to seal a place in the World Cup finals, ending a 40-year wait for the team and Al-Hamadi, who got his 17th and fifth senior goal. The Republic of Ireland’s World Cup bid ended after a 2-2 draw with Czechia in the play‑off semi-final, losing on penalties. Captain Dara O’Shea started (now 43 caps), while Jack Taylor (11 caps) and Chiedozie Ogbene (32 caps; on loan at Sheffield United) also started. Sammie Szmodics ( on loan at Derby County) was stretchered off after coming on in extra time and spent the night in hospital before returning to the UK.
